@@ -2962,27 +2962,30 @@ we use "-o" to indicate the rule of conpare. 23/sep/2009
/*
icu_toUChars() seems not working here, using u_strFromUTF8 instead. (04/mar/2019)
*/
+
+/*
+On Windows, u_strFromUTF8() fails but u_strFromUTF8WithSub()
+with U_SENTINEL (-1) ---> 0xfffd works.
+So I use u_strFromUTF8WithSub() by replacing 0xffffffff --> 0xfffd.
+--ak (05/mar/2019)
+*/
+
/*
uchlen1 = icu_toUChars(entry_strs, (ptr1 * (ENT_STR_SIZE+1)), lenk1, uch1, ucap);
uchlen2 = icu_toUChars(entry_strs, (ptr2 * (ENT_STR_SIZE+1)), lenk2, uch2, ucap);
*/
- u_strFromUTF8(uch1, ucap, &uchlen1, (char *)&ENTRY_STRS(ptr1, 0), lenk1, &err1);
- u_strFromUTF8(uch2, ucap, &uchlen2, (char *)&ENTRY_STRS(ptr2, 0), lenk2, &err1);
+ u_strFromUTF8WithSub(uch1, ucap, &uchlen1, (char *)&ENTRY_STRS(ptr1, 0), lenk1, 0xfffd, NULL, &err1);
+ u_strFromUTF8WithSub(uch2, ucap, &uchlen2, (char *)&ENTRY_STRS(ptr2, 0), lenk2, 0xfffd, NULL, &err1);
/*
- In my Windows build, the above fails: err1 != U_ZERO_ERROR, which
- gives access violation in ucol_open(). Maybe my ICU build is wrong.
- In this case I use the original functions which seem not working,
- only to avoid a crash by access violation. Thus I cannot support
- correct behavior for bibtexu on Windows. -- A. Kakuto 2019/03/05
+ If err1 != U_ZERO_ERROR, we use the original functions.
*/
